The composition of the king’s of Aragon Casa i Cort. Norms and Practices at the Beginning of Peter the Ceremonious’ Reign

In order to understand better the functioning of the court of the kings of Aragon at the end of the Middle Ages, its national composition and regular attendance, this paper offers a study of Peter the Ceremonious’ Casa i Cort for the years of 1345, 1346, based on royal ordinances and accounting records
